Sophie accidentally puts her hand on an open flame, she immediately withdraws her hand. This is an example of a reflex reaction. Describe how a reflex reaction is coordinated.

Reflex reactions are subconscious, they bypass the brain. Receptors detect a sensory stimulus, in this case- pain. Receptors stimulate sensory neurons, creates an electric impulse which travels to the spinal cord- "ow pain!!"Sensory neuron then synapses with the relay neuron- "we need to stop the pain!"The relay neuron then synapses and passes the signal to the motor neuron- "move your hand!" the motor neuron sends this signal to the effector (in this case, the muscles in the hand requiring it to be moved). The hand then moves away from the flame.
